I was setting up a mini crankshaft in an ER 32 collet this morning. It occurred to me that I should clean the swarf out of the collet and holder.
Also occurred to me I don't know what the reference surface is in the collet? Is it the inside of the cap? Or is it the inside angle of the body of the holder that determines how the collet seats? Or both? Seems like swarf builds in the cap in hard to reach spots.
Mostly curious but I figure if one is more important I should concentrate my swarf cleaning to the important surface.
